Specifications

Product Information

Model IE9281-FM
Hardware Intel CPU: Intel Core i7 (8th Generation) or higher, Memory: 32GB or above, HDD: 500GB or above
OS Linux
Maximum Number of Faces in Database 50,000
Network 10/100/1000 Mb Network
Maximum Number of Devices Connecting Up to: 256
Power Input 100-240V AC
Power Consumption Max. 90W
Dimensions 250 x 44.2 x 225 mm
Weight 4 kg
Safety Certifications CE, FCC, VCCI

Persons of Interest (POI) Management

POI Management · Enroll person using Web client.
· Manage face profiles database through Web Portal
POI Authentication · Using Face as a credential
· Using Card Number
POI Groups · Default groups: VIP, Blacklist, Staff
· User defined person groups
POI Batch Enrollment Supports bulk enrollment using Excel & JPEG files
Enrollment Photo · Min. face size = 200 x 200 pixel
Requirements · 1MB Max. photo size (.JPG or .PNG)
POI Profile Information · Name, ID #, card #, job position, email, phone, POI group(s), and expiration date

POI Reports

Investigation Reports Generate facial recognition reports and filter events by:
· Location
· Time period
· Name
· POI Group
· POI type (enrolled or stranger)
Attendance Reports Generate staff clocking reports and filter events by:
· Clock-in time
· Clock-out time
· Stay length
· Late Arrival
· Early Leave
Actions Reports Generate a report for which pre-defined actions were triggered in response to an event.
Export Data Export results to Excel file

Trigger Rules and System Actions

Rule Engine Rule based engine to trigger single or multiple system actions based on:
· Event Location
· Schedule
· Detection time period
· Specific POI profile
· POI face group affiliation
· Person type (enrolled or stranger)
· POI is (not) a member of a group
Supported System Actions · Trigger I/O Relay
· Trigger IP-to-Wiegand converter
· Send HTTP GET/POST command
· WebSocket notification

Facial Recognition Verticals

Possible Applications · Identify potential troublemakers (shoplifters, criminals or any other barred individuals)
· Detect VIP members upon arrival to deliver a tailored experience
· Provide physical entry to commercial buildings, residences, and other rooms
· Contactless staff clock in system
· Verify visitor’s identity
